Performance Capture

We deliver complete performance capture services, from pre-shoot planning and live direction to post-processing and retargeting, ensuring accurate, production-ready data for animation and integration.

Planning & On-Set Supervision

From pre-shoot planning to live sessions, our team oversees shot preparation, reference materials, prop setup, and real-time feedback to ensure each performance meets production goals.

Capturing Body & Facial Performances

Full-body and facial motion is captured using optical system, calibrated for precision, synchronization, and performance consistency.

Data Processing & Post-Production

Captured data is cleaned, retargeted, and refined into production-ready animation assets.

What do you actually record?

We record full body motion and facial expressions at the same time, in one synchronized take. The actor wears a motion capture suit and a head mounted camera, so you get a single, coherent body and face performance that can be applied to your character.

Performance capture is used for both cinematic and gameplay content where acting and realistic performance really matter. Typical use cases include in game cinematics, dialogue scenes, hero moments, complex interactions between characters and any situation where body language and facial expressions need to match tightly.

To plan efficiently we need a script or shot list, basic character descriptions, information about your target engine and skeletons, and any visual or acting references you have. Animatics, storyboards or gameplay captures are very helpful. This preparation lets us plan shot order, camera layout, rehearsal time and the most efficient use of the stage.

We focus on body and facial capture, but we can also provide reference audio from microports. If needed, we can help you keep timing consistent between mocap and final audio, and support lipsync synchronization.

How is performance capture post-production is priced?

We work on an hourly basis, with different rates for specific services. There is a separate hourly rate for stage time during the shoot, and different rates for services such as directing, on set technical supervision, cleanup, retargeting and export. Before the session we provide a clear estimate that shows planned hours per service, so you can see exactly where the budget goes.
